Why Spray Polyurethane Foam (SPF) Is the Standard for High-Performance Insulation
Spray polyurethane foam is the only insulation type that combines air sealing, thermal insulation, and moisture control in a single application. Pioneer JYYJ high-pressure plural-component machines (25–36 MPa) deliver consistent cell structure across closed-cell (40–50 kg/m³, R-6.5/inch) and open-cell (8–10 kg/m³, R-3.7/inch) systems — covering every building type from residential retrofits to industrial cold storage.
Compared to fiberglass batts, SPF achieves 35–50% higher whole-wall R-value because it eliminates thermal bridging and air infiltration losses. Compared to cellulose, it doesn't settle over time. With proper machine calibration and substrate prep, an SPF system installed today carries its R-value for 50+ years without degradation.

Wall Cavity Insulation
Closed-cell 50mm or open-cell 90mm in stud cavities. R-13 to R-21 typical. Eliminates draft and improves indoor air quality.
Attic Floor + Knee Walls
Closed-cell 75-100mm. Stops air leakage in #1 heat-loss zone. Enables attic-to-living-space conversion.
Basement & Crawlspace
Closed-cell 50mm on rim joists and walls. Moisture barrier + mold prevention + 24-36 month payback.
Rim Joist Sealing
Closed-cell 50mm targeting the #2 cause of residential heat loss. Often retrofitted in one afternoon.
Attic Living Space
Open-cell 150-200mm for sound damping + thermal performance with budget efficiency.

Steel Frame Walls
Closed-cell 75-100mm. IECC 2021 / ASHRAE 90.1 compliant in single application. Eliminates need for separate vapor barrier.
Flat Roof Decks
Closed-cell 75-100mm direct-to-deck. Adds R-20+ while doubling as air barrier. 50+ year service life.
Masonry Cavity Walls
Closed-cell injected into block cavities. Continuous insulation per IECC 2021 with no thermal bridging.
Interior Sound-Damping
Open-cell 50-90mm in interior partitions. 50-80% airborne sound reduction. Common in hotels, hospitals, offices.

Dairy Barns + Calf Hutches
Closed-cell 75mm with vapor barrier. Withstands washdown chemicals. Maintains barn temperature in -30°C winters.
Poultry Housing (Blackout)
Closed-cell 50-75mm. Special black-tinted formulation for layer hen blackout requirements. Pest-resistant continuous seal.
Livestock + Equine Barns
Closed-cell 50-75mm. Controls radiant heat in summer + retains body heat in winter. Reduces feed conversion stress.
Grain Silos + Storage
Closed-cell on silo exteriors. Prevents condensation that triggers grain spoilage. Adds structural integrity to aging silos.
Greenhouses
Closed-cell on north walls + foundation. Reduces heating cost 40-60% in commercial greenhouse operations.

Cold Storage / Freezer
Closed-cell 100-150mm. -20°F to -40°F service. R-value retention verified per ASTM D2126 freeze-thaw cycling.
Process Pipe Insulation
Closed-cell 25-50mm wraps. Hot pipe (steam/process water) + cold pipe (refrigeration). Industrial chemistry plants.
Metal Building Roofs
Closed-cell direct-to-metal over purlin systems. Eliminates condensation drip + R-30+ in single application.
Tank / Vessel Exterior
Closed-cell 50-75mm. Industrial storage tanks, fermentation vessels. Reduces evaporative loss + temperature control.

Technical Considerations
- Density selection: 40–50 kg/m³ for structural roofs and below-grade; 8–10 kg/m³ for interior walls and ceilings
- Substrate prep: must be clean, dry, dust-free, and above 5°C surface temperature for proper adhesion
- Recommended thickness: 50–100mm for walls, 150–200mm for roofs and attics depending on climate zone
- Voltage matching: confirm 220V single-phase or 380V three-phase before order — electrical specs are non-trivial
- Ignition barrier required per IRC R314 — typically ½-inch gypsum board or ICC-ES approved intumescent coating
- Ventilation during application: spray crews need PPE and project area must be evacuated until cure (~24h)
- Climate window: ambient temperature 5–35°C, RH below 85%, no rain or condensation on substrate
- Storage of A/B components: 15–25°C, sealed drums, use within 6 months of manufacture
- Mix ratio calibration: 1:1 by volume (typical) — drift over 5% causes friability or sticky cure
- Hose temperature setting: 38–66°C depending on chemistry and ambient, heated hose 15–30m typical
